    --  Public Safety and Security - In January 2015, the FCC significantly
        increased accuracy requirements for locating mobile customers indoors
        and outdoors. "The public rightfully expects 911 location technologies
        to work effectively regardless of whether a 911 call originates indoors
        or outdoors," the commission said. Under the new rules, mobile operators
        must be able to provide public safety organizations with the capability
        to pinpoint a wireless 911 caller's location to within 50 meters. Mobile
        operators must meet this requirement for 40 percent of all 911 calls
        within two years, increasing to 80 percent over the next six years. The
        January 2015 rules will create additional market opportunities, but to
        capitalize on them, mobile operators and public safety organizations
        require a new generation of seamless, indoor-outdoor location
        technologies supplied by an ecosystem of highly innovative vendors,
        including TCS.
    --  TCS Trusted Location - TCS can verify and validate a device's location
        nearly anywhere in the world, in near real-time. Utilizing a variety of
        location technologies - including cellular, GPS, Wi-Fi and satellite -
        TCS' Trusted Location algorithms calculate a "Trust Score" to report the
        level of certainty associated with the location and authenticity of the
        device. This is a powerful tool for identifying fraud, preventing "false
        positive" denials of services, and confirming location compliance for
        regulated industries, such as financial services and online gaming.
